"Geoff's Little Sister" by Evelyn R. Garratt is a children's novel written in the late 19th century. The story revolves around the experiences of a young boy named Geoffrey and his siblings as they cope with the absence of their mother, who has recently passed away. The book explores themes of family, loss, and the innocence of childhood, portraying how the characters navigate their grief while caring for their younger sister, Dodie. In this touching narrative, Geoffrey, the eldest of the siblings, feels a deep sense of responsibility for his younger siblings, particularly Dodie. As the family prepares for Christmas without their mother, they struggle with their emotions and each child's unique way of dealing with grief. Geoffrey reflects on the past while fulfilling a promise to buy a new doll for Dodie, who is still sweet and naive about their mother's absence. The story reaches a poignant climax with Dodie's unexpected illness and subsequent death, which forces Geoffrey to confront his own emotions and musters the strength to support his grieving father. Throughout, the narrative beautifully captures the essence of childhood and familial bonds, ultimately conveying a profound message about love, loss, and resilience.
